Miss America Does Not Have Date This Year
By JOHN CURRAN, Associated Press Writer
Sun Jun 19, 2:57 PM ET
ATLANTIC CITY, N.J. - In any other year, Miss Delaware Becky Bledsoe would be making her travel plans. The folks at Fischer Florists would know when they have to deliver all the corsages and bouquets. Boardwalk Hall would have a two-week period blocked out for pageant rehearsals, preliminary competitions and the crowning of the new Miss America.
But this is not any other year. Miss America doesn't have a date, and the uncertainty has her world in a tizzy.
With three months to go before its traditional start, the beauty pageant is still without a TV contract and has yet to establish a date for the crowning, which traditionally is held in early September.
"It is, candidly, looking more and more like September's out of the picture," said Bob Arnhym, executive director of the Miss California Scholarship Pageant. "Logistically, there's an awful lot of detail that has to be attended to."
Dropped by ABC last fall because of record-low viewership, the Miss America pageant has been searching for a new television outlet to carry the 84-year-old pageant.
Art McMaster, CEO of the Miss America Organization, has declined repeated requests for an interview about the pageant's hunt for a new TV outlet. Spokeswoman Jenni Glenn said Friday the pageant is in "final negotiations with interested networks" and will have an announcement within two weeks.
Keeping the pageant on the air is a necessity — both for visibility's sake and because the Miss America Organization has historically depended on TV revenue to run the show and pay for the scholarships awarded to contestants. In 2003, $5.6 million of its $6.9 million in revenue came from ABC, according to its tax return.
The delay in setting a date has left state pageants, their contestants, Miss America vendors and the operators of Boardwalk Hall — where Miss America is named each year — in limbo.
"I'm asked all the time, `Hey, what's going on with Miss America?'" said Jeffrey Vasser, executive director of the Atlantic City Convention and Visitors Authority. "Art McMaster assures me there will be a pageant this year. They do have a couple opportunities on the table, but he wouldn't tell me what they are."
Pageant officials have said they are considering a shift away from the tired formula of the telecast — which drew only 9.8 million viewers last year — in favor of something more in line with reality TV shows.
After being cast off by ABC, they hired talent agency William Morris and are said to be aggressively pursuing cable networks, with McMaster proposing to "open up the sacred doors of Miss America," as he told an interviewer in April.
Instead of a once-a-year special that struggles to interest viewers, McMaster has pitched the idea of Miss America as a show aired over several nights, with viewers getting to know the contestants as they do on "American Idol" and other reality shows.
Whatever it is, Miss America's next TV outlet will likely scotch the saccharine speeches about world peace in favor of televised backbiting among the women vying for the crown.
"I don't think there's an audience for squeaky clean," said Shari Anne Brill, director of programming for ad-buying firm Carat. "It has to be modernized in the way we've all been fed such reality. You need to see the tears, the drama, the makeup, the mascara, the crisis of finding out you have a zit."
Meanwhile, the Miss America world waits.
"I'm getting impatient. I want to know," said Leah Summers, who runs the Miss West Virginia Scholarship Pageant.
"Every year, we end the show with a line like `Congratulations to the new Miss West Virginia, Suzie Q, and please join us as we watch her compete in Atlantic City on September 19th.' We can't say that this year. We can't say where or when."

Juneteenth fest will be fitting - and fun, too;
[STATE Edition] SEUN MIN KIM. St. Petersburg Times
St. Petersburg, Fla.: Jun 16, 2005. pg. 3
This year's Juneteenth Celebration in Pasco County is more than a whirl of pageants, forums, free Haagen-Dazs ice cream and the tune of joyful gospel voices resonating throughout Zephyr Park, organizers say. It's a fitting tribute to the generations of African- Americans who suffered under years of slavery.
The Black Caucus of Pasco County and the city of Zephyrhills will host the second annual Juneteenth celebration starting tonight with a discussion on human rights issues, which leads into a weekend that includes a pageant, gospel fest and celebrations at individual homes and churches.
All events are free and open to the public.
Juneteenth, which celebrates the end of slavery in the United States, is needed so that similar atrocities won't ever again occur, organizer and community activist Blanche Benford said.
"You can't go back 200 years and redo things," Benford said. "It is inhumane to treat another human like that, and this is important so my granddaughter and her grandchildren and their grandchildren will know where we came from."
New to Zephyrhills' version of the holiday celebration is the Miss Juneteenth pageant, to be held Friday to recognize young black women in Pasco County. Miss Juneteenth hopefuls can still register for the pageant by contacting Benford at (813) 312-6345.
The forum tonight and the Miss Juneteenth pageant at 7 p.m. Friday will be at the American Legion Post 118, 5340 Eighth St., in Zephyrhills.
Zephyr Park will be filled with gospel voices Saturday as part of a daylong festival with various vendors, dancers, speakers, hot-air balloon rides and a barbecue.
The annual celebration remembering the plight of enslaved blacks in U.S. history will close Sunday, the day officially designated as Juneteenth, with recognition in several area churches about the significance of the holiday.
Though all events are free, the Black Caucus hopes to collect donations to launch a scholarship fund for young black men and women in Pasco County.
